National Sales Manager Queensland & Northern Territory - South Bank, QLD
n
Job no: 531858
n Brand: FCM
n Work type: Full time, Hybrid
n Location: New South Wales, Queensland, Victoria
n Categories: Sales and Customer Service
n
About the Opportunity:
n
Ready to win big? As a Large Market Sales Manager, you will be responsible for securing new enterprise and multinational business, leading complex sales opportunities, and building influential relationships with senior decision-makers. This is a high-impact role where you'll shape growth strategy, negotiate major contracts, and help expand our presence across key markets. Join a collaborative team that thrives on ambitious goals, strategic thinking, and delivering exceptional results.
n
Key Responsibilities:
n
- Drive new business acquisition across enterprise and multinational customers.
n
- Lead complex sales cycles, develop strategic account plans, and build relationships with executive stakeholders.
n
- Present tailored solutions, negotiate high-value contracts, and achieve revenue growth targets.
n
- Partner with internal teams to deliver a seamless customer experience from prospecting through to onboarding.
n
- Represent the brand at industry events, conferences, and trade shows.
n
- Contribute to a safe, inclusive, and accessible work environment where all Flighties feel welcomed, respected, and supported to thrive.
n
Experience and Qualifications:
n
- 3+ years' experience in B2B sales,
including experience winning enterprise or multinational customers.
n
- Proven success managing complex, high-value sales opportunities and exceeding revenue targets.
n
- Strong consultative selling, executive stakeholder engagement, and contract negotiation skills.
n
- Experience with Salesforce or similar sales enablement platforms and a relevant tertiary qualification.
n
- Ability to travel nationally and internationally as required.
n
- Ideally located in Brisbane, however Sydney and Melbourne candidates will also be considered depending on experience
